80 businesses offer over 2 thousand job vacancies - Ribaj: The need for a new bridge of cooperation between the state and entrepreneurship

The labor market in Albania is going through a dynamic phase where the demand for labor remains high. At the last fair, about 80 businesses have announced their vacancies, aiming at the immediate recruitment of personnel in various profiles. Beyond direct employment, increased attention is being paid to career guidance.
Vocational secondary education is being promoted as a strategic choice for students and parents, aiming for faster and more qualitative integration into the labor market.
Gertiola Çepani, Director of Labor Market Services, AKPA: "At this fair, there are over 80 businesses that have announced job vacancies, but we also have the participation of universities, vocational training centers, and employment offices. Of the employers that are at the fair, there are about 2,000 job vacancies, in addition to the 5,500 others that are already actively announced on the employment portal puna.gov.al. In addition to employment, in fact, at this fair we also promote secondary vocational education for all parents or students who want to choose secondary vocational education as one of the best choices now for integration into the labor market."
The need for a more flexible approach to market changes is seen as the key to success, with the private sector remaining the fastest in adopting innovations.
Artur Ribaj Pedagog: "The fair is a meeting place between parties that must have common interests, where they can exchange their opinions and offers or requests to be achieved and fulfilled. It is very well organized, it is necessary, but there should be more participation. I also think that there should be greater cooperation between public institutions and private universities, which are more flexible in adapting to the market and changes and needs. So, in the private sector we always have faster access to changes and innovations."
The challenges of the labor market require not only vacancies, but above all proper qualification and coordination of business demand with academic offer.
